Purpose: To investigate the microstructure of cystoid macular edema (CME) in retinitis pigmentosa (RP) and the associated vascular changes using optical coherence tomography (OCT) angiography. Methods: In this retrospective study, we included 42 eyes of 21 patients with RP and age-similar normally sighted controls who underwent both OCT and optical coherence tomography angiography. Using OCT, spatial distribution of CME and the retinal layer, which CME located, was examined. Optical coherence tomography angiography images of the superficial capillary plexus and deep capillary plexus were obtained. Foveal and parafoveal flow densities in each layer and foveal avascular zone area were measured. Results: Of the 42 eyes with RP, 32 had CME. All CMEs were located in the inner nuclear layer and limited to the parafovea. The outer nuclear layer/ganglion cell layer was involved in 12 eyes (37.5%). Compared with RP without CME, RP with CME (RP-CME) did not show significant differences in flow density or extent of vascular disruption within the superficial capillary plexus, deep capillary plexus, or foveal avascular zone areas. Conclusion: RP-CME was mostly located in the inner nuclear layer of the parafoveal macula, without vascular disruption in optical coherence tomography angiography. Our findings may support the hypothesis that the pathogenesis of RP with CME differs from retinal vascular CME triggered by compromised deep capillary plexus.
